Background Image

Our Software Services

Empower Your Organization with Leading-Edge Technology Services

Improving is the leading IT consulting and software engineering company in North America. We help enterprises and organizations solve their most complex technology challenges through modern software development, technology consulting, agile training, and team augmentation services. Whether your business needs to understand the impact of a new initiative, deploy a new application, or partner with a trusted firm that can assimilate into your team, Improving is here to help! We are dedicated to educating and supporting your business each step of the way.

How Can We Help Your Business?

IT Outsourcing Services

We provide a variety of IT outsourcing services through our Guadalajara and Aguascalientes, Mexico enterprises. Engaging with our Nearshore resources enables organizations to equip their project teams with experienced Improving consultants and developers at a reduced rate without having to coordinate across multiple time zones. Delve into the benefits of cost-efficiency, real-time collaboration, and proximity through our nearshore outsourcing services.

  • Nearshore Outsourcing

  • Nearshore Software Development

  • Nearshore IT Consulting

  • Nearshore Software Testing

Nearshore workers in meeting
Woman Developer working

Software Development Services

In search of a holistic solution for your business platform's design, development, or modernization needs? Look no further than Improving. We offer a collaborative approach that engages your engineers throughout your project lifecycle. Our Improvers are dedicated to supporting your organization's goals through disciplined project management, agile software development, and leveraging progressive technologies and development methodologies to guarantee the solution we build for you provides real business value. Learn more about our software development and engineering services below.

  • Custom Software Development 

  • Enterprise Application Development

  • Frontend & Mobile Development

  • Cloud Application Development

IT Consulting Services

Our IT consulting services empower your organization to review various technology strategies, helping you align these strategies with your business goals while supporting your strategic, architectural, and implementation planning. Our background in training and coaching gives us a unique advantage in understanding how these strategies are communicated to your stakeholders, project leaders, and business partners, which ensures a seamless transition from strategy to planning to execution. Explore our full range of IT consulting services below.

  • Software Consulting

  • Digital Transformation Consulting

  • Cloud Consulting

  • Cybersecurity Consulting

Nearshore Improvers Working
Improving Training Services

Training Services

Our team of instructors provides a variety of training opportunities for organizations, groups, and individuals seeking to improve their agile or development competencies. We provide flexible learning environments, regularly offering both private and public certification courses and workshops virtually, on-site, or at many of our Improving enterprises. Learn more about our agile training and coaching services.

  • Agile Certification Training

  • Executive & Leadership Coaching

  • Software & Development Training

  • Team & Private Training

Community Services

Our Improvers are committed to giving back. As such, we offer several services dedicated to providing our community with invaluable resources to improve their businesses, personal lives, and opportunities. Find out more about our community services and how you can get involved.

  • CodeLaunch

  • Improving Talks / Webinars

  • User Groups

Community Services

Ready to Get Started?

Contact us today and let's build something great together.